What are the hourly rates of plumbers in Houndsditch?

The usual hourly rate for a plumber in Houndsditch typically falls between £40 and £70, depending on factors such as location, job complexity, and the plumber’s experience.

The cost of hiring a plumber will be different from job to job:

  • Fixing a burst water pipe could come in anywhere from £60 to £160
  • Installing a new sink is usually somewhere in the region of £120 to £300.

What to ask a Houndsditch plumber before hiring?

Before hiring a plumbing contractor in Houndsditch or plumbing company in Houndsditch, here are some key questions you should ask along with helpful insights:

What training and qualifications do you have as a plumber in Houndsditch?

Plumbers in Houndsditch should hold industry-recognised qualifications such as NVQ Level 2 or 3 in plumbing and heating. Many have also completed apprenticeships and ongoing training to keep up with the latest standards and regulations.

Will the plumbing work in Houndsditch comply with current building regulations and standards?

Plumbers in Houndsditch should confirm that all work meets local building codes and safety standards. They often provide certificates for gas safety or water regulations compliance where applicable, ensuring work is safe and legal.

What experience do you have with similar plumbing projects in Houndsditch?

Ask for examples or references related to the specific job you need, whether it’s fixing leaks, installing boilers, or bathroom plumbing. This shows familiarity with similar tasks in your area. You can also view customer reviews and photos of a local Houndsditch plumber’s work on MyBuilder.

How long will the plumbing work take to complete?

Small repairs might take an hour or less, while installations or refurbishments could last several days. A Houndsditch plumber should always give you a clear estimate based on your project details.

Do you offer a guarantee or warranty on your plumbing work?

Most plumbers in Houndsditch provide warranties ranging from one to several years, covering both parts and labour. This helps ensure that if issues arise after the job is completed, they can come back and fix them.
